Here are a few other random tips that I have found online that I think are quite clever not included in the list:
-If cutting up a fruit for a lunchbox (e.g an apple) slice it up vertically and tie it back together with a rubber band to prevent the fruit going brown during the day!
- I don't know if this would work in practice but I have been told that if you are in a rush, boil potatoes in their skins and then once they are cooked immediately drop them into ice cold water for a second and the skin will just fall off!
-An easier way to peel a banana! Open it from the opposite end to the stem by squeezing, apparently this is the way that monkeys do it and maybe us humans should learn something from them!!

- If you are going to the beach, put your phone/camera into a ziplock bag to protect it. Put valuables in an old sunscreen tube or tissue box as people rarely steal those!
- If you need to unseal an envelope to add something forgotten, put it in the freezer for 45 mins and the seal will unstick without ripping.
-Parked your car on a street you haven't heard of? Take a photo of your car and the street name on your phone so you can easily locate it later.
-Put glowsticks in balloons for instant atmospheric garden party lights.
-Aloe vera gel/cold wet teabags on sunburn.
-use a staple remover to open a keyring instead of breaking your nails.
